26 * No hardware documentation available outside of NVIDIA.
27 * This driver programs the NVIDIA SATA controller in a similar
28 * fashion as with other PCI IDE BMDMA controllers, with a few
29 * NV-specific details such as register offsets, SATA phy location,
30 * hotplug info, etc.
32 * CK804/MCP04 controllers support an alternate programming interface
33 * similar to the ADMA specification (with some modifications).
34 * This allows the use of NCQ. Non-DMA-mapped ATA commands are still
35 * sent through the legacy interface.

410 * NV SATA controllers have various different problems with hardreset
411 * protocol depending on the specific controller and device.
413 * GENERIC:
415 * bko11195 reports that link doesn't come online after hardreset on
416 * generic nv's and there have been several other similar reports on
417 * linux-ide.
419 * bko12351#c23 reports that warmplug on MCP61 doesn't work with
420 * softreset.
422 * NF2/3:
424 * bko3352 reports nf2/3 controllers can't determine device signature
425 * reliably after hardreset. The following thread reports detection
426 * failure on cold boot with the standard debouncing timing.
428 * http://thread.gmane.org/gmane.linux.ide/34098
430 * bko12176 reports that hardreset fails to bring up the link during
431 * boot on nf2.
433 * CK804:
435 * For initial probing after boot and hot plugging, hardreset mostly
436 * works fine on CK804 but curiously, reprobing on the initial port
437 * by rescanning or rmmod/insmod fails to acquire the initial D2H Reg
438 * FIS in somewhat undeterministic way.
440 * SWNCQ:
442 * bko12351 reports that when SWNCQ is enabled, for hotplug to work,
443 * hardreset should be used and hardreset can't report proper
444 * signature, which suggests that mcp5x is closer to nf2 as long as
445 * reset quirkiness is concerned.
447 * bko12703 reports that boot probing fails for intel SSD with
448 * hardreset. Link fails to come online. Softreset works fine.
450 * The failures are varied but the following patterns seem true for
451 * all flavors.
453 * - Softreset during boot always works.
455 * - Hardreset during boot sometimes fails to bring up the link on
456 * certain comibnations and device signature acquisition is
457 * unreliable.
459 * - Hardreset is often necessary after hotplug.
461 * So, preferring softreset for boot probing and error handling (as
462 * hardreset might bring down the link) but using hardreset for
463 * post-boot probing should work around the above issues in most
464 * cases. Define nv_hardreset() which only kicks in for post-boot
465 * probing and use it for all variants.

696 if (ap->link.device[sdev->id].class == ATA_DEV_ATAPI) {
698 * NVIDIA reports that ADMA mode does not support ATAPI commands.
699 * Therefore ATAPI commands are sent through the legacy interface.
700 * However, the legacy interface only supports 32-bit DMA.
701 * Restrict DMA parameters as required by the legacy interface
702 * when an ATAPI device is connected.
704 segment_boundary = ATA_DMA_BOUNDARY;
705 /* Subtract 1 since an extra entry may be needed for padding, see
706 libata-scsi.c */
707 sg_tablesize = LIBATA_MAX_PRD - 1;
709 /* Since the legacy DMA engine is in use, we need to disable ADMA
710 on the port. */
711 adma_enable = 0;
